This candle holder builds on the redneck wine glass idea. You can make it pretty simply by yourself, but I admit there was a point where I could have used an extra finger as I knotted the lace and ribbon.
Tools:
Hot Glue Gun
Scissors
Supplies:
Canning Jar (Dollar Store)
Glass Candle Stand (Dollar Store)
Pearls ( upcycled jewelry)
Beads
Prima Flowers
White Mesh Lace
Red Satin Ribbon
Seagreen Organza Ribbon
Instructions:
- Tie mesh lace around jar.
- Tuck red and seagreen ribbon under mesh lace knot.
- Tie Prima Flowers with ribbon.
- Use hot glue gun to affix pearls and red beads to jar amidst flowers, and pearls to base of candle holder.
- Place a few beads into candle holder base.
- Trace glue around top edge of candle base and place decorated jar on top. Let dry.
- Add tealight.
